Is Elden Ring cross-platform?

Unfortunately, Elden Ring does not have cross-platform support. You’ll never be able to explore with your friend on PC if you’re playing on console.

What the game does have is cross-gen support. This means that if you’re playing on either of the PlayStation systems –the  4 or 5 — then you can all play together in co-op or competitively. The same goes for both Xbox systems, with PC being left isolated as well. No console player can match up with anyone on PC. Whatever system you get the game on, you can only play with people on that same system.

At the very least, Elden Ring does offer free generation upgrades, such as for PS4 to PS5, for anyone who might not have their hands on the new systems yet, but still want to pick up the game.
